Hey, welcome to the rotation!

Quick heads-up on the Fernwick firmware channel: device updates for the Larkbell sensors go out in staged rings, and the thing that pages most often is a stuck ring promotion. Usually it's a checksum mismatch holding the gate closed — don't force-promote without checking the canary fleet first. Rollbacks are safe but slow, about forty minutes per ring. Everything you need, including the promotion checklist and who to ping after hours, lives on the internal channel-ops page.

operations page: https://confluence.nelvroworks.example/dash/spaces/board/job/pipeline/issue/spaces/b9c0f0fbc164027c4eb481af

Subject: Handover — BranchSweep bot database duties

Hi Verelle,

Handing over BranchSweep ahead of the release freeze. The bot scans repos nightly, flags branches idle over 60 days, and records decisions in its own Postgres schema so nothing touches the release tooling. Please pause it during the freeze window via the admin flag, not by killing the service. Its state database is reachable with the string below.

Regards,
Domas

replica DSN, kajep-yahag: mssql://praok_svc:iF@db-8d68.plorvaio.local:5432/eliion

- [ ] Rotate the Lanterngrove search-cluster signing key before the nightly reindex kicks off at 23:30. Pause the Skimmerfish crawler, confirm the index snapshot completed, then perform the unseal with both custodians present. If the reindex job stalls, restore from the escrow copy using the passphrase written immediately below.

unlock words, fawif-hahip: eliax-ulador-holdor-novix-prawyn-norius-kelax-weniel-alddor-ulaion